Bid technical clarifications are ongoing at Saudi International Petrochemical Company (Sipchem) on its second-phase project to build a large-scale carbon monoxide (CO) and purification plant at Jubail. Four teams of international contractors submitted proposals in the spring for the estimated $150 million-175 million package, which also includes offsites and utilities work. A final contract award is expected in the fourth quarter.
